Title :
Calculation of pulse wave propagation in a quasi-TEM line using mode expansion in time domain

Abstract :
The paper considers pulse propagation in a transverse inhomogeneous waveguide supporting a quasi-TEM wave. The calculation is based on presenting the sought fields in terms of mode expansion with mode amplitudes being functions of time and longitudinal coordinate (Mode Basis Method). In case of transverse inhomogeneous waveguide there is coupling between the modes. Meanwhile a very good convergence of such a mode series is shown here. The obtained solution was verified by direct FDTD calculation.
